ABOUT ARDI


Atlas Relief and Development International (ARDI) is an international development nonprofit organization working to empower diverse communities affected by conflict to shape and participate in the peaceful, inclusive, rights-based, and secure futures they envision.

ARDI specializes in supporting civilians affected by the conflict in Syria.

ARDI is registered in the United States, Germany, Turkey, Iraq, and Syria; and we operate in areas affected by conflict and migration.

ARDI leads programming across a wide variety of development projects, including expertise in peacebuilding, women's empowerment, capacity building, civil society strengthening, political participation, economic empowerment, technical research, awareness-raising, and the amplification of diverse and minority voices.
